How To Fix HRFPM372 - Absolute is not possible for relative period determination


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: HRFPM - Messages Budget Planning & Budget Execution

  • Message number: 372

  • Message text: Absolute is not possible for relative period determination

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message HRFPM372 - Absolute is not possible for relative period determination ?

    The SAP error message HRFPM372, which states "Absolute is not possible for relative period determination," typically occurs in the context of SAP Human Capital Management (HCM) or SAP SuccessFactors when there is an issue with how periods are defined or calculated in a specific process, such as payroll or time management.

    Cause:

    The error usually arises due to the following reasons:

    1. Incorrect Configuration: The system is trying to determine a relative period (like a month or a quarter) but is being instructed to use an absolute date or period. This mismatch can occur in various configurations, such as in payroll processing or time evaluation.

    2. Period Definitions: The period definitions in the system may not be set up correctly. For example, if the system expects a relative period (like "last month") but is given an absolute date (like "January 1, 2023"), it will trigger this error.

    3. Data Entry Issues: There may be incorrect or incomplete data entries in the relevant infotypes or configuration tables that lead to this error.

    Solution:

    To resolve the HRFPM372 error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ings for the relevant module (e.g., payroll, time management) to ensure that the period definitions are set correctly. Make sure that the system is configured to use relative periods where necessary.

    2. Review Period Settings: Go to the relevant transaction codes (like PE03 for payroll schemas or PT60 for time evaluation) and check the period settings. Ensure that the settings align with the expected input (relative vs. absolute).

    3. Data Validation: Validate the data entries in the infotypes related to the process you are executing. Ensure that all required fields are filled out correctly and that there are no inconsistencies.

    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ific module you are working with. There may be specific guidelines or known issues that can provide further insight.

    5. Testing: After making changes, perform a test run to see if the error persists. This can help confirm whether the adjustments made have resolved the issue.

    6. Seek Support: If the issue continues, consider reaching out to SAP support or consulting with an SAP expert who can provide more tailored assistance based on your specific configuration and setup.
